K语言
K是专有的阵列处理编程语言,由Arthur Whitney开发,并由Kx Systems商业化。这个语言充当了内存内列式数据库kdb+,和其他有关财务产品的基础[1]。这个语言最初开发于1993年,是APL的变体并包含了Scheme的元素。这个语言的提倡者强调了它的速度、在处理阵列上的设施和富有表达力的语法[2]。
编程范型 | 阵列, 函数式 |
---|---|
设计者 | Arthur Whitney |
实作者 | Kx Systems |
发行时间 | 1993年 |
型态系统 | 动态, 强类型 |
网站 | kx |
启发语言 | |
A+, APL, Scheme | |
影响语言 | |
Q |
参见
引用
- ^ Kx Systems. [2020-05-24]. (原始内容存档于2020-02-01).
- ^ Iverson, Kenneth. Notation as a Tool of Thought. [2015-02-23]. (原始内容存档于2013-09-20).
外部链接
- 官方网站, Kx Systems
- 官方网站, kdb+
- Overview of K (with a link to K reference card) (页面存档备份,存于互联网档案馆)
- Dennis Shasha - K as a Prototyping Language (页面存档备份,存于互联网档案馆)
- Michael Schidlowsky - Screencast comparing solutions of a specific problem(页面存档备份,存于互联网档案馆) in K vs. Java
- K by Arthur Whitney (2005)(页面存档备份,存于互联网档案馆)
- oK (页面存档备份,存于互联网档案馆) REPL for a K clone
- Kona (页面存档备份,存于互联网档案馆) an open-source K3 implementation
这是一篇关于电脑程式语言的小作品。您可以通过编辑或修订扩充其内容。 |